How do I enter my loan interest if it is under $600 and I do not have a 1098?

Follow these steps to enter your interest:

  1. Click on Deductions & Credits.
  2. Click on Show more beside Your home.
  3. Click on Start (or Revisit) beside Mortgage Interest and Refinancing (Form 1098) even though you do not have a Form 1098
  4. Answer Yes to the question Did you pay any home loans in 2019?
  5. Enter the name of your Lender on the next screen and click Continue.
  6. Select the radio button beside The seller is financing this loan and I didn't receive a 1098.
  7. Provide as much information as possible about your lender on the next page and click Continue.
  8. Provide interest and other loan information on the next page and click Continue again.
  9. Continue through the rest of the section making the appropriate selections as they apply to your loan.

How do I enter my loan interest if it is under $600 and I do not have a 1098?

Are you asking about a mortgage loan or a student loan?


Student loan interest is reported on Form 1098-E. The lender is not required to send you Form 1098-E if the interest was less than $600. But you do not need the form in order to enter the interest in TurboTax, as long as you know the amount. You only have to enter the name of the lender and the amount of interest.


Mortgage interest is reported on Form 1098. A mortgage lender is not required to issue Form 1098 if the interest was less than $600. Form 1098 is never required for a seller-financed mortgage, regardless of the amount of interest. Mortgage interest that was not reported on Form 1098 has to be entered on Schedule A line 8b. If it is a seller-financed mortgage follow the instructions that SusanY1 provided above. However, if it is not a seller-financed mortgage there is no way to make the entry in TurboTax Online. The entry can only be made in forms mode. Forms mode is only available in the CD/Download TurboTax software, not in TurboTax Online.


Also note that mortgage interest is an itemized deduction. It will not make any difference in your tax or your refund unless your total itemized deductions are more than your standard deduction.
